1. A method for decoding a sequence of pictures, each of which is partitioned into a plurality of sub-regions each including at least one coding tree block, on a basis of the sub-regions, the method comprising:
decoding, from a bitstream, a first flag for indicating whether an inter prediction constraint is imposed on all of the sub-regions in a picture;
decoding, from the bitstream, layout information for representing sizes and positions of the sub-regions;
in response to the first flag not indicating that the inter prediction constraint is imposed on all of the sub-regions, decoding a second flag corresponding to each of the sub-regions from the bitstream, the second flag indicating whether the inter prediction constraint is imposed on the sub-region corresponding thereto;
in response to the first flag indicating that the inter prediction constraint is imposed on all of the sub-regions, inferring the second flag corresponding to each of the sub-regions as a value indicating that the inter prediction constraint is imposed on the sub-region corresponding thereto; and
for a target sub-region to be decoded in a current picture among the sub-regions defined by the layout information, decoding a coding block partitioned from a coding tree block in the target sub-region by performing an inter prediction depending on the second flag corresponding to the target sub-region,
wherein, when the inter prediction constraint is imposed on the target sub-region, the coding block is inter-predicted without referencing to the other sub-regions than a sub-region in a reference picture which corresponds to the target sub-region in the current picture.
